In my system alsa0.9.0rc6 is installed with a SBLive! card. Via the digital output of my CDROM sound is transferred to the soundcard and is available at the analog output.
The problem is that the sound samples are not available for processing (I am using BruteFIR) in software taking input from ALSA. This has worked before but after installing a new version of linux SUSE8.1 and updating ALSA it does not work anymore.


What confuses me is that the sound is available in the soundcard and the input/output volume control in alsamixer works, however, software cannot take input from ALSA.

What can be the problem here? Do I need to set a switch?
